About Tank

Meet Tank! This 6-year-old handsome mixed breed is ready to find his forever home and enjoy the second half of his life surrounded by love. He arrived at the shelter a bit underweight and with irritated skin, but thanks to some tender care, he's looking much better now. Tank has shown to be great with other dogs here, so a canine companion could be a good match, pending a successful meet and greet. He does not do well with children and prefers a calm environment. A low rider with short legs, Tank isn't keen on rigorous exercise — he's more of a couch potato who enjoys relaxing by your side. Although he's been let down by people before, he's eager to trust again with the right family. Come and meet this gentle boy and see if he's the companion you’ve been looking for!
